Malin Head, Ireland – 11-18 June 2016

Pat Spencer is running a trip to Malin Head, Ireland  June 11-18th  2016. The plan is for 6 days diving and 7 nights’ accommodation.  Mixture of wrecks, reefs, walls, drop offs and caves. Viz around 20m

Boat and diving.

We are planning to dive with Mevagh Divers in Donegal on their boat the Laura Dean, which is a hard boat with lift.

They can offer a mix of inshore boat diving, drift diving and some wreck diving on The Julia T, recently named as one of the “100 Essential Wreck Dives”. They also have some great shore diving in their beautiful private sheltered cove which has a wreck the’60 footer’ lying in 13 metres depth, easily accessible from the shore.
